Abstract :
The effect of the localized longitudinal impedance is investigated by using the Vlasov equation approach. The motivation is trying to explain the observed discrepancy between the analytical study and numerical simulation on the bunch lengthening phenomenon. The νs =m/2l resonances are found to play a noticeable role. As another application of this treatment, synchro-betatron resonances are also recovered
